I'd go for the Disneystore one, it's £20 and has the pull string, DS1 has it (he's 2) and DS2 (9 months) likes to pull the string. I don't think I would get a more expensive one for their age and as far as I know this is the cheapest pull-string one around.

i would also go for the disney store one, although my son has the £40 one with over 50 phrases but this is his main prezie, my daughter also has the £40 jessie but to save the fighting between them they each have a woody and jessie from the disney store, at £20 each i must say side by side to the more expensive ones i would save yourself the money lol, i wish i did
